NHL All-Star Game Results

NHL Public Relations @PR_NHL

First Game: Team McDavid (Pacific All-Stars) vs Team MacKinnon (Central All-Stars)

First Period Summary:
1-0 (PAS) Goal- Nathan MacKinnon – Assists: Cale Makar, Sidney Crosby at 3.24
1-1 (CAS) Goal – Boone Jenner – Assists: Nick Suzuki, Tomas Hertl at 7.58

First Period PAS Goalie: Connor Hellebuyck – 7 saves
First Period CAS Goalie: Alexandar Georgiev – 7 saves

Second Period Summary:
2-1 (CAS) Goal – Oliver Bjorkstrand – Assists: Travis Konecny, Elias Lindholm at 5.51
3-1 (CAS) Goal – Nathan MacKinnon – Assists: Sidney Crosby, Cale Makar at 6.45
3-2 (PAS) Goal – David Pastrnak – Assists: Connor McDavid, Tomas Hertl at 9.28
3-3 (PAS) Goal – Connor McDavid – Assists: David Pastrnak, Leon Draisaitl at 9.54

Second Period (PAS) Goalie: Sergei Bobrovsky – 8 saves
Second Period (CAS) Goalie: Jeremy Swayman – 8 saves

Shootout: (PAS) Connor McDavid – Goal
(CAS) Sidney Crosby – Miss
(PAS) Leon Draisaitl – Miss
(CAS) Nathan MacKinnon – Miss
(PAS) David Pastrnak – Goal

Pacific All-Stars win 4-3(SO)

Second Game: Team Matthews (Atlantic All-Stars) vs Team Hughes (Metropolitan All-Stars)

First Period Summary:
1-0 (MAS) Goal – Nikita Kucherov (1) – Unassisted at 1.19
1-1 (AAS) Goal – Alex DeBrincat (1) – Assists: Filip Forsberg (1), Mathew Barzal (1) at 2.43
2-1 (MAS) Goal – Frank Vatrano (1) – Assists: Quinn Hughes (1), Cam Talbot (1) at 3.32
2-2 (AAS) Goal – Alex DeBrincat (2) – Unassisted at 5.07

First Period (AAS) Goalie: Jake Oettinger – 7 saves
First Period (MAS) Goalie: Cam Talbot – 4 saves

Second Period Summary:
3-2 (AAS) Goal – Mitch Marner (1) – Assists: Clayton Keller (1) at 2.17
3-3 (MAS) Goal – Elias Pettersson (1) – Assists: Frank Vatrano (1), Nikita Kucherov (1) at 4.18
3-4 (AAS) Goal – Filip Forsberg (1) – Assists: Vincent Trochek (1), Mathew Barzal (2) at 4.45
4-4 (MAS) Goal – Brady Tkachuk (1) – Assists: Quinn Hughes (2) at 7.02
5-4 (MAS) Goal – Frank Vatrano (2) – Assists: Quinn Hughes (3) at 7.35
5-5 (AAS) Goal – Filip Forsberg (2) – Assists: Alex DeBrincat (1), Mathew Barzal (3) at 8.08

Second Period (AAS) Goalie: Igor Shesterkin – 7 saves
Second Period (MAS) Goalie: Thatcher Demko – 6 saves

Final Game: Team McDavid (Pacific All-Stars) vs Team Matthews (Atlantic All-Stars)

First Period Summary:
1-0 (AAS) Goal – Clayton Keller (1) – Assists: Auston Matthews (2) at 2.19
1-1 (PAS) Goal – Boone Jenner (2) – Assists: Nick Suzuki (2) at 5.06
2-1 (AAS) Goal – Mitch Marner (2) – Assists: William Nylander (1), Vincent Trocheck (2) at 7.11
2-2 (PAS) Goal – David Pastrnak (2) – Assists: Leon Draisaitl (3) at 8.08
3-2 (AAS) Goal – Auston Matthews (1) – Assists: Clayton Keller (2) at 8.13
3-3 (PAS) Goal – Leon Draisaitl (1) – Assists: Connor McDavid (2), David Pastrnak (2) at 8.26

First Period (PAS) Goalie: Sergei Bobrovsky – 11 saves
First Period (AAS) Goalie: Igor Shesterkin – 8 saves

Second Period Summary:
3-4 (AAS) Goal – Filip Forsberg (3) – Assists: Mathew Barzal (4), Alex DeBrincat (2) at 1.06
5-3 (AAS) Goal – Auston Matthews (2) – Assists: Clayton Keller (3), Mathew Barzal (5) at 4.57
6-3 (AAS) Empty Net Goal – Alex DeBrincat (3) at 8.09
6-4 (PAS) Goal – Tomas Hertl (1) Assists: Leon Draisaitl (4), Nick Suzuki (3) at 8.34
7-4 (AAS) Goal – Mathew Barzal (1) Assists: Alex DeBrincat (3), Filip Forsberg (2) at 8.54

Second Period (PAS) Goalie: Connor Hellebuyk – 7 saves
Second Period (AAS) Goalie: Jake Oettinger – 8 saves

Atlantic All-Stars win the All-Star Tournament 7-4

All-Star MVP Award Winner: Auston Matthews
